Distinguished by its sector-led approach, the litigation, arbitration and investigations practice at Linklaters acts for domestic and international corporate entities in investigations and proceedings related to numerous matters in the field of white-collar crime. Stefaan Loosveld specialises in litigation and contentious restructuring and insolvency, leading the team alongside Xavier Taton, who handles various business criminal law and regulatory matters for clients in the financial and energy sectors, and experienced litigator Florence Danis.
